Technical Details of Eaton Tripp Lite Series 3.8kW Single-Phase Switched ATS PDU

  • Power rating: 3.8 kW maximum load to support multiple servers, switches, storage, and other IT equipment in a single rack footprint.
  • Power inputs: Two 200-240V IEC C20 inlets provide redundant sources from UPS, generator, or auxiliary power feeds.
  • Outlets: 8 x C13 outlets and 2 x C19 outlets to accommodate a mix of standard and high-current devices.
  • Phase and connection: Single-phase configuration designed for reliable operation in standard data center environments.
  • Height and form factor: 1U rack-mount PDU, 19-inch rack compatible for space-efficient deployment in dense IT cabinets.
  • Compliance: TAA-compliant, suitable for government and enterprise deployments that require traceable and compliant equipment.

How to Install Eaton Tripp Lite Series 3.8kW ATS PDU

  • Prepare the rack: Ensure you have a clean, vibration-free 19-inch equipment rack with adequate airflow. Verify that the mounting rails are properly aligned and compatible with 1U PDUs. Confirm that both UPS or power sources are de-energized before installation.
  • Mount the PDU: Slide the PDU into the rack slots and secure it with screws through the mounting rails. Confirm that the front face of the PDU is easily accessible for outlet connections and power management tasks. Position the PDU so that cable management is straightforward and does not impede airflow.
  • Connect power sources: Attach two power feeds to the C20 inlets using appropriate C20-to-wall or generator cables that match your data center’s power architecture. Ensure both input sources are rated for 200-240V and that connections are snug and compliant with local electrical codes. Do not energize equipment until all connections are complete.
  • Attach devices to outlets: Route device cables to the eight C13 outlets and two C19 outlets according to power requirements. Balance loads across outlets where possible to prevent overloading any single circuit. Label cables to simplify future management and troubleshooting.
  • Test the transfer switch: With loads connected, simulate a loss of one input source under controlled conditions to verify automatic transfer to the alternate source. Observe the PDU indicators to confirm the switch operation, and confirm that connected devices remain powered during the transfer. Document the transfer behavior and ensure any alarms or indicators function as expected.
  • Finalize setup: Configure any optional monitoring features per your environment and establish maintenance windows for routine checks. Implement a backup power strategy that aligns with your IT service levels, and keep a clear map of outlet assignments for future expansion or changes.

Frequently asked questions

  • Q: What does “Switched Automatic Transfer Switch” mean for this PDU?

    A: It means the PDU automatically transfers power between two independent 200-240V sources (inlets) to maintain uptime for connected equipment. If one source fails or dips below a threshold, the PDU switches to the backup source without user intervention, reducing downtime and preserving critical operations.

  • Q: How many outlets and what types are provided?

    A: The PDU offers eight C13 outlets and two C19 outlets, giving you flexibility to power a mix of standard servers, storage devices, and higher-demand equipment from a single rack-mount power distribution solution.

  • Q: Can this PDU handle full capacity with two feeds?

    A: Yes. The design supports a maximum load of approximately 3.8 kW at 200-240V, which translates to about 15.8 A at 240V. Distribute this load thoughtfully across outlets to avoid overloading any single circuit and to maintain reliable performance.
